The Importance of Soft Skills: Key Skills Sought by Recruiters

In the job search process, soft skills play a crucial role. These personal skills, often overlooked by candidates, have become essential in the eyes of recruiters. They allow for evaluating your ability to integrate harmoniously into a team and adapt to a company's culture. So, what are the most in-demand soft skills today? And how can you develop them to increase your chances of success in your job search?


 



 

1- The most in-demand soft skills by recruiters:

- Communication: The ability to actively listen and effectively communicate with others is a key skill in every professional field.

- Interpersonal Skills: Respect, the ability to work in a team, and collaboration are highly valued qualities by employers.

- Leadership: Recruiters are looking for candidates who can take on responsibilities and act with integrity.

- Learning: Autonomy and intellectual curiosity are skills that demonstrate your ability to quickly adapt to new situations and continuously learn.

- Intrapersonal Skills: A positive attitude, self-confidence, and effective stress management are essential personal skills in the professional world.

- Reflection and Imagination: Employers value candidates who can creatively solve problems and have an open attitude towards innovation.

2- Tips for developing your soft skills:

-Develop your communication skills by actively practicing listening and improving your oral and written communication.

- Cultivate positive interpersonal relationships by showing respect, empathy, and promoting teamwork.

- Pursue continuous personal development by seeking learning opportunities and expanding your knowledge and skills.

- Cultivate a positive attitude towards yourself and others, and work on your self-confidence to approach professional challenges with assurance. - Practice solving problems creatively and consider new perspectives to stimulate your thinking and imagination.



 

Soft skills have become an essential criterion in the recruitment process. By understanding the most sought-after skills by recruiters, you can highlight your strengths and increase your chances of success in your job search. So, focus on these personal skills and continuously develop them!
